Output 26b84e255f017976d2569b4c73077e6776294357fff5dd24609cd3173aab9deb:0

value
153271
script pubkey
OP_0 OP_PUSHBYTES_20 807af270efbc4589af5fec8589093fa37c9f74d3
address
bc1qspa0yu80h3zcnt6lajzcjzfl5d7f7axn9uyet3
transaction
26b84e255f017976d2569b4c73077e6776294357fff5dd24609cd3173aab9deb
confirmations
336505
spent
true